Tucson, Arizona is a popular retirement city for both year-round and part-time living due to the mild climate, abundant sunshine, and plentiful activities.
With its scenic beauty, culinary delights, and warm weather, Tucson is an ideal place to embrace the joys of life in the golden years.
Read on for information about Tucson neighborhoods, activities, dining options, and healthcare recommendations specifically catered to individuals aged 55 and above.


There are a number of older adult neighborhoods and communities scattered around Tucson, particularly in the suburbs of Catalina, Catalina Foothills, Green Valley, Oro Valley, and Sahuarita.
Before you can find the right fit, it's important to define your terms.
Active Adult Living: Active adult communities are designed for totally independent active adults who are seeking to maximize their empty nester chapter with athletic, academic, and social pursuits.

Independent Living: Independent living is a term used for seniors who need some level of assistance (even if it is minor). These communities often offer in-house services, such as meals, laundry, housekeeping, and medical assistance, along with planned activities to enhance quality of life.
Assisted Living: Assisted living communities offer a higher level of support and typically have various professionals (doctors, nurses, physical therapists, etc) on-site to help with daily challenges and medical care.

Some older adults prefer a more multi-generational style of living and do not want to live in a specifically 55+ community. If this describes you, you may be interested in searching for a home in one of these safe and vibrant suburbs of Tucson:
Oro Valley: Nestled in the picturesque Santa Catalina Mountains, Oro Valley offers a tranquil and scenic environment for active adults. With well-maintained communities, golf courses, hiking trails, and stunning views, it's a haven for outdoor enthusiasts seeking an active lifestyle.
Catalina Foothills: Known for its upscale atmosphere, Catalina Foothills combines luxury living with natural beauty. Residents can enjoy golfing, hiking, and breathtaking desert vistas, along with a variety of shopping and dining options.

What is a "snowbird"?
Some older adults, coined as "snowbirds," spend half the year in Tucson and half the year elsewhere (often blizzardy places, such as Montana, Michigan, Iowa, or up north in Canada).
